应该是下面的C..struct employee{char name[20];
c是错的,aa已经是定义出的一个结构体变量。
结构体的定义 结构体的一般表现形势为 struct 结构体名{ 成员列表 }; 在成员列表中可以是几种基本数据类型如char,int等,也可以是结构体类型(可以是这个... }R。
对于自定义的数据类型struct s{ long a;char b;};,返回的就是该结构体内所有基本数据类型所占字节数的总和,所以sizeof(struct s)应该返回sizeof(long)+s。
关于c语言struct函数: c语言struct函数是:C语言中用来定义一系列具有相同类型或不同类型的数据构成的数据集合,也叫结构体。 C语言中的struct是用户自定义数据。
用include包含 定义的结构体 变量声明不能放在头文件中,因为很容易造成重定义。假如有如下结构体typedefstructA{chara[10];}A;那在main函数所在的c。
结构体的数据类型的有点多我们就不啰嗦了,直接来看相同数据结构体的几种书写的格式吧。格式一:01.struct tagPhone02.{03. char A;04. in。
有关C语言结构体和数组很多教程以及书籍里都会讲解的,都是C语言里比较基础的知识点。以前学习C语言看的是“如鹏网”的《C语言也能干大事》视频教程,有详细的讲。
在C语言中,struct和typedef struct都可以用来定义结构体,但它们的作用有所不同。1. struct用来定义结构体类型,需要在定义变量时加上struct关键字。。
需要包含stdio.h这个头文件 需要包含stdio.h这个头文件
回顶部 |